    The weather has been good down South over the past week. Fishing on the Waiau River 7pm - 9pm (in the dark).

    Hooked into 7+ fish on Wednesday - landed 4, tossed one brown back to live another day, lost 3+ rainbow after they jumped and spit the fly

    Hooked into 10+ fish on Friday - landed 4, lost 6+, nabbed an eel with knife while cleaning trout

    Major rise going on from 7pm to 9pm - had fish at my feet when I turned on my head lamp !

    I am not sure what that big ugly fly is called - it looks like some variant of a "bugger streamer" - maybe an UGLY BUGGER STREAMER

    It is not articulated.

    Here is a photo of 4 different flies that I used over two hours (7pm - 9pm) on the same night - and landed a fish with each.

    The small black dry is a Black Gnat - looks like a Twilight Beauty - but is black - obviously.
